The “Crescendo Cantando” Choir of the Montessori School “Casa di Irma” Bedano is directed by the talented music teacher Barbara Busana.

The school choir won a few years ago the competition of our Association with the song “Il battito del cuore”, which was awarded thanks to the originality of the piece and the idea of peace defined by our hearts beating in unison.

The “Cantori della Turrita” Choir of Bellinzona, directed by Director Daniela Beltraminelli, is a non-profit singing school based on volunteer work. The school offers young people the chance to engage in group musical activities while also fostering social interaction and friendship. 

The choir performs concerts with a polyphonic repertoire ranging from the Renaissance to the present day, including a variety of musical genres. 

In 2015 Julia Gertseva founded the “La Musica” cultural educational project in Lugano with the aim of teaching vocal technique, interpretation, scenic movement and to make students learn the secrets of theatrical presentation.

It is a construction and training program that provides advanced discipline to allow children a future artistic path.

The chorus of white voices “La Musica” during these years has participated in numerous concerts and charity events of our Association Culture Ticino Network.
